Heim  >  Artikel  >  Backend-Entwicklung  >  So migrieren Sie nahtlos von MySQL zu MySQLi: Eine Schritt-für-Schritt-Anleitung

So migrieren Sie nahtlos von MySQL zu MySQLi: Eine Schritt-für-Schritt-Anleitung

Linda Hamilton
Linda HamiltonOriginal
2024-11-03 11:09:021013Durchsuche

How to Seamlessly Migrate from MySQL to MySQLi: A Step-by-Step Guide

Migration von MySQL zu MySQLi: Eine detaillierte Anleitung

Die Migration Ihrer Website von MySQL zu MySQLi bietet verbesserte Leistung und Sicherheit. Dieser Leitfaden bietet einen umfassenden Überblick über den Prozess.

Überlegungen zur Datenbank

Im Gegensatz zu vielen Datenbankmigrationen erfordert dieser Übergang keine Änderungen auf der Datenbankseite. Die Änderungen erfolgen ausschließlich innerhalb des PHP-Codes.

PHP-Funktionsersetzungen

Ja, Sie können die veralteten MySQL-Funktionen durch MySQLi-Funktionen ersetzen. MySQLi bietet eine Reihe moderner und hochoptimierter Äquivalente für jede MySQL-Funktion.

Zusätzliche Überlegungen

Neben der Funktionssubstitution sind noch einige andere Faktoren zu berücksichtigen:

  • MySQL-Erweiterung aktivieren: Stellen Sie sicher, dass die MySQL-Erweiterung in Ihrer PHP-Konfiguration aktiviert ist.
  • Verwenden Sie PHP7.4 oder höher: MySQLi Die Unterstützung ist in PHP7.4 veraltet und wird in zukünftigen Versionen entfernt. Erwägen Sie ein Upgrade auf eine kompatible Version.
  • Verwenden Sie vorbereitete Anweisungen: Vorbereitete Anweisungen erhöhen die Sicherheit, indem sie SQL-Injection-Angriffe verhindern. Sie sollten immer dann verwendet werden, wenn Sie Abfragen ausführen, die Benutzereingaben erfordern.
  • Fehler elegant behandeln: MySQLi bietet eine robuste Fehlerbehandlung. Implementieren Sie eine ordnungsgemäße Fehlerprüfung und -behandlung, um alle Probleme reibungslos zu lösen.

Konvertierung in MySQLi

Die Konvertierung Ihres PHP-Codes in MySQLi ist unkompliziert. Hier ist ein Beispiel für eine Abfrageausführung mit MySQL und MySQLi:

MySQL:

<code class="php">$resource = mysql_query($query);</code>

MySQLi:

<code class="php">$resource = mysqli_query($conn, $query);</code>

Empfohlene Ressource

Weitere Anleitungen finden Sie in der MySQLi-Dokumentation zum Konvertieren in MySQLi. Es bietet wertvolle Informationen und Tools zur Unterstützung des Migrationsprozesses.

Das obige ist der detaillierte Inhalt vonSo migrieren Sie nahtlos von MySQL zu MySQLi: Eine Schritt-für-Schritt-Anleitung.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Stellungnahme:
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n